A local gym celebrated five years of operation on Saturday, marking a significant milestone in its journey to promote health and fitness in the community. The event was filled with excitement as members, staff, and fitness enthusiasts gathered to commemorate the occasion.
Throughout the day, various activities were organized, including fitness classes, demonstrations, and competitions that showcased the gym's diverse offerings. Members were encouraged to participate in fun challenges, with prizes awarded to those who excelled. The atmosphere was vibrant, with music and refreshments adding to the festive spirit.
In addition to the activities, the gym took the opportunity to thank its loyal members for their support over the years. The owners expressed their gratitude, emphasizing their commitment to providing a welcoming environment and top-notch facilities. As the gym looks to the future, plans for new classes and community events are already in the works, ensuring that it continues to be a hub for health and wellness for years to come.
